Patent number: 10907858Abstract: The present disclosure relates to a power transmission system for actuating a damper. The power transmission system includes an input shaft configured to rotate about a first axis and a first input dog rotatably coupled to the input shaft. The power transmission system also includes a second input dog coupled to the first input dog. The first input dog includes a first arrangement of teeth extending along a second axis and the second input dog includes a second arrangement of teeth extending along the second axis. The first input dog and the second input dog are configured to move axially along the second axis to enable engagement and disengagement of the first and second input dogs with first and second output dogs, respectively. The first and second output dogs are configured to engage with respective damper blades of the damper.Type: GrantFiled: September 4, 2018Date of Patent: February 2, 2021Assignee: Air Distribution Technologies IP, LLCInventors: Vikas A. Patil, A K S Manian, Parmeshwar G. Patil, Rajesh D. Vyas, Atul A. Shitkande, Kapil D. Sahu

Patent number: 10598398Abstract: A control system, comprising one or more smoke sensors, each configured to measure a level of smoke at a location within a building and to output a smoke level signal based at least in part upon the measured level of smoke. A controller configured to receive the smoke level signals and to control an operation of one or more energy recovery ventilation systems in a first mode of operation to recover energy when the smoke level signal is below a predetermined value and in a second mode of operation to evacuate smoke when the smoke level signal is above the predetermined value.Type: GrantFiled: March 15, 2013Date of Patent: March 24, 2020Assignee: Air Distribution Technologies IP, LLCInventors: Josiah Wiley, Michael G. Longman
